Output 23b203a672db4de58ac63f9c7d2f15566309abb637e035d30117ba2450058262:0

value
601081468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07778d19131a7b3f2e8362deebf955afddaac3f0 OP_EQUALVERIFY OP_CHECKSIG
address
1gUwuPhz17zeBz85n4QadjEz3JpDGBBeT
transaction
23b203a672db4de58ac63f9c7d2f15566309abb637e035d30117ba2450058262
spent
true